1. The Derma Co 1% Salicylic Acid Gel Face Wash (30ml)
Price: ₹99
If you're dealing with blackheads, whiteheads, or acne congestion, this gentle salicylic acid face wash is a standout. With just 1% salicylic acid, it exfoliates without irritating sensitive skin and maintains the skin’s natural pH.
It’s especially useful before applying hydrating layers in a skin flooding routine, as it creates a clean base without over-stripping.
Best for: Oily, acne-prone, or combination skin
Use: AM or PM, as your first step in cleansing

2. Minimalist 2% Hyaluronic Acid Serum (15ml)
Price: ₹269
This minimalist formulation includes multi-molecular weight hyaluronic acid and vitamin B5. Unlike heavier formulations that pill or sit on top of skin, this serum absorbs quickly and binds water at multiple skin layers. It’s a solid step one in any hydrating routine and ideal for layering under lightweight moisturizers.
If you’re following the hydration layering method discussed here, this pairs beautifully with other lightweight products like gel moisturizers.
Best for: Dry, dehydrated, or uneven skin.
Use: Right after misting or on damp skin before moisturizing.

3. Pond’s Super Light Gel with Hyaluronic Acid + Vitamin E (49g)
Price: ₹124
Highly rated and widely loved, this moisturizer offers serious hydration without heaviness. With a gel-cream texture and both hyaluronic acid and vitamin E, it locks in moisture without clogging pores — making it a perfect finishing step in your daily hydration stack.
This product also works well under sunscreen during the day or as part of your post-cleansing evening routine.
Best for: Normal, oily, or combination skin types
Use: After serum, AM and PM

4. Dot & Key CICA Calming Skin Renewing Night Gel (15ml)
Price: ₹275
Formulated with Centella Asiatica (CICA), niacinamide, and probiotics, this soothing gel is ideal for those with irritated, inflamed, or acne-prone skin. It’s especially effective in calming redness or inflammation after using actives like salicylic acid or niacinamide.
In fact, if you’ve read our guide on barrier repair after exfoliation, this is one of the products that fits that recovery window perfectly.
Best for: Sensitive, irritated, or inflamed skin.
Use: PM routine, as a final calming layer.

5. Himalaya Aloe Vera Moisturizing Gel (100ml)
Price: ₹58
A classic, this pure aloe vera gel is a multi-use product that works as a calming gel mask, a moisture primer, or even a light pre-serum hydrator. The texture is ideal for all skin types and works especially well when skin feels overheated, sun-exposed, or sensitized.
For readers of our summer skincare routine post, this is one of the simplest ways to add soothing hydration on high-UV days without adding layers of product.
Best for: All skin types, especially sensitive or sun-exposed skin.
Use: AM and PM, as needed under or instead of moisturizer.
